Peterson, the 18-year-old badminton star from Thailand, continued his impressive form when he qualified for the Hong Kong Open from 2025.
2 days ago, Pitchamon caused excitement when he defeated a series of Chinese players and thus won the Baoji China Masters 2025. It was also the second BWF World Tour title in the career of this “badminton wonder”.
Thanks to this championship, Pellchamon also made a leap in the ranking of the Badminton World Federation (BWF). She rose from 49th to 40th place in the world ranking and to 36th place in the World Tour.
However, this achievement was not enough for PETCHAMON to officially get a ticket for the Hong Kong Open, one of the largest badminton tournaments.
In the qualifying round she took on the Taiwanese opponent Tung Ciou-Tong, who is 54th on the world ranking.

With its impressive performance, Podchamon provides a stir in the badminton world – Photo: Instagram
Podchamon only had trouble in the first game when she won 21-19. In the second game she easily won 21-13.
Thanks to this victory, Petchamon officially qualified for the Hong Kong Open, a memorable milestone in the career of the 18-year-old girl.
However, the chance that Podchamon will get far is small because she has to compete against her senior Chochuwong in the first round. Chochuwong is currently sixth on the world ranking and is at her age.
